More strange moves - Fling, Water Spout and Gyro Ball

Words: Raymond Padilla, GamesRadar US

Gyro Ball's damage uses the following formula: 25 X enemy Speed/user Speed. So if the target's Speed is 200 and the attacker's Speed is 50 then Gyro Ball will hit for base 100. In the hands of slower Steel Pokemon, this move can be wicked thanks to the STAB damage. Bronzong, Magnezone, and Steelix can pack quite a wallop with Gyro Ball.
